Richard "Rick" Hunter is a character in the Robotech television series.At the start of the Macross Saga, his role is that of an amateur stunt pilot [2] — throughout his numerous appearances and mentions in primary sources, he quietly evolves into an Admiral of Earth's last fleet, as he attempts to lead the liberation of Earth from numerous alien threats.

Out in space, a ship from the SDF-3 expedition de-folds from hyperspace and attempts to engage the Masters' fleet but is destroyed. Supreme Commander Leonard and General Emerson debrief Major John Carpenter, the ship's commanding officer, who informs them that the Robotech Expeditionary Force will not be sending any more combat units back to Earth.
